5. Ferries: Sailing the Cook Strait

Cook Strait ferry New Zealand

Connecting the North and South Islands of New Zealand actually includes crossing the very Cook Strait. What I am saying is actually done usually either on Interislander or the Bluebridge. You are able to easily take a ferry between Wellington and Picton. You see those wonderful seaside looks while enjoying services and like restaurant options right in those things! Also I really am feeling it could even wind up one main highpoint in one adventure.

Also you might often book such travel ahead! In some respects it is even more true for traveling alongside a vehicle.
